art photonics GmbH, founded in Berlin in September 1998, is one of the worldwide leaders in development and production of specialty fiber products for a broad spectrum from 300 nm to 16 µm. Unique technologies of Polycrystalline Mid InfraRed (PIR-) fibers and Metal coated Silica fibers are used for assembly of various spectroscopy probes for medical diagnostics and industrial process control, in volume production of fiber for medical and industrial lasers, for different fiber bundles, etc. Since January 2024 art photonics GmbH is a member of NYNOMIC GROUP.

Introduction to art photonics GmbH Founded in 1998, art photonics GmbH is a leading provider of intelligent optical solutions, offering a broad spectrum of services from the development of advanced fiber products to full-spectrum process control solutions. Our offerings span across various industries, including chemical, petrochemical, pharmaceuticals, life sciences, food, and polymers.
Core Competencies and Services
Technological Expertise: Art photonics is renowned for its innovative use of Polycrystalline Mid Infrared (PIR) fibers, making it a global leader in specialty fiber product development.
Customized Solutions: We offer tailored R&D services, from concept to mass production, including:
Spectroscopic fiber probes for ATR-absorption, UV-Vis-NIR transmission, diffuse reflection, Raman, and fluorescence methods.
Development of Mid-IR fiber cables, probes, and bundles for diverse applications, including scientific, medical, and industrial sectors.
Comprehensive Services: Our services include prototype manufacturing, OEM production, consultancy, training, and installation & calibration of spectroscopy systems.

Key Features
High Sensitivity: Transflection probes with a collimated beam design for UV-Vis or Vis-NIR spectral ranges.
Versatile Raman Probes: Available for multi-wavelength (630-785 nm) and single-wavelength (532, 785 nm) excitations.
Durability: High-pressure, high-temperature capabilities with various ATR crystals for optimal chemical compatibility.
Spectroscopy Probes
Mid-IR Standard ATR Probes: Featuring flexible fibers, protective crown tips, and Hastelloy C22 shafts, suitable for a wide range of spectroscopic applications.
High-Temperature ATR Probes: Designed for extreme conditions, capable of withstanding up to 250°C and 200 Bar pressure.
Sterilizable ATR Probes: With gas cooling design, ideal for sterile environments in the pharmaceutical and life sciences industries.
Laboratory Probes: Specialized for precise laboratory measurements with various shaft materials and spectral ranges.

Metal coated fibers (Cu- and Al-) are the optimal solution for applications in high temperature, vacuum and harsh environment conditions. They are available in:
UV-VIS (High-OH) and VIS-NIR (Low-OH) ranges;
Single mode and Multimode with core diameters up to 600 um;
